
Petit Manou Medoc 2018
The Petit Manou is another great example of the value of buying second wines in great Bordeaux vintages. The Petit Manou 2018 is the second wine of the 91-point Clos Manou 2018, and it shares many of its big brother's qualities, being big, bold, well-extracted and packed with black and red fruits backed by notes of cedar, mocha and minerals. At its drinking peak now, enjoy this with grilled meats, creamy cheeses, tomato-based dishes or as a satisfying solo sipper.

About the Producer
Clos Manou, a consistently impressive Médoc estate punching above its weight, showcases the potential of the northern Médoc. Expect Cabernet Sauvignon to take the lead, delivering structure, dark fruit, and a pleasing gravelly minerality. Often displaying surprising concentration and aging potential for its appellation, it represents excellent value and a more rustic, terroir-driven expression of the Left Bank. A name to watch.
